At the Mercy of Mother Nature

We started our 2 month Western US filming trip in San Francisco with an opportunity to interview Brother David Steindl-Rast. In our sharing together we could see that Christianity in it’s essence has the same understanding and is pointing to the same Divine reality as all the other spiritual traditions. They may dress themselves in different overcoats but underneath, their … Read More